Python Flask app to log detections from Cylance API

import requests | |
import json | |
import time | |
from datetime import datetime, timedelta | |
import jwt | |
import uuid | |
from flask import Flask | |
from config import Config | |
app = Flask(__name__) | |
# Populate config.py with Cylance credentials | |
app.config.from_object(Config) | |
# Cylance API configuration | |
APP_ID = app.config['APP_ID'] | |
TENANT_ID = app.config['TENANT_ID'] | |
APP_SECRET = app.config['APP_SECRET'] | |
LOG_FILE_PATH = app.config['LOG_FILE_PATH'] | |
# If your region code is different, your base URLs may be different | |
CYLANCE_API_AUTH_ENDPOINT = f'https://protectapi.cylance.com/auth/v2/token' | |
CYLANCE_API_DETECTIONS_ENDPOINT = f'https://protectapi.cylance.com/detections/v2?start={{start_time}}&end={{end_time}}' | |
CYLANCE_API_DETECTION_ENDPOINT = f'https://protectapi.cylance.com/detections/v2/{{detection_id}}/details' | |
def get_access_token(timeout=1800): | |
# Token expiry | |
now_utc = datetime.utcnow() | |
timeout_datetime = now_utc + timedelta(seconds=timeout) | |
epoch_time = int((now_utc - datetime(1970, 1, 1)).total_seconds()) | |
timeout = int((timeout_datetime - datetime(1970, 1, 1)).total_seconds()) | |
# Token UUID | |
jti_val = str(uuid.uuid4()) | |
# JWT request claims | |
claims = { | |
'exp': timeout, | |
'iat': epoch_time, | |
'iss': 'http://cylance.com', # Issuer | |
'sub': APP_ID, | |
'tid': TENANT_ID, | |
'jti': jti_val | |
} | |
# Encode the request with JWT | |
encoded_req = jwt.encode(claims, APP_SECRET, algorithm='HS256') | |
payload = {'auth_token': str(encoded_req)} | |
headers = {'Content-Type': 'application/json; charset=utf-8'} | |
response = requests.post(str(CYLANCE_API_AUTH_ENDPOINT), headers=headers, data=json.dumps(payload)) | |
return json.loads(response.content)['access_token'] | |
def get_detections(access_token, start_time, end_time): | |
headers = { | |
'Content-Type': 'application/json', | |
'Authorization': f'Bearer {access_token}', | |
'User-Agent': 'cypyapi' | |
} | |
endpoint_url = CYLANCE_API_DETECTIONS_ENDPOINT.format(start_time=start_time,end_time=end_time) | |
params = { | |
'page': 1, | |
'page_size': 200 | |
} | |
response = requests.get(endpoint_url, headers=headers, params=params) | |
response.raise_for_status() | |
response_data = response.json() | |
return response_data['page_items'] | |
def get_detection(access_token, id): | |
headers = { | |
'Content-Type': 'application/json', | |
'Authorization': f'Bearer {access_token}', | |
'User-Agent': 'cypyapi' | |
} | |
endpoint_url = CYLANCE_API_DETECTION_ENDPOINT.format(detection_id=id) | |
params = { | |
'page': 1, | |
'page_size': 200 | |
} | |
response = requests.get(endpoint_url, headers=headers, params=params) | |
response.raise_for_status() | |
response_data = response.json() | |
return response_data | |
def write_to_log_file(data): | |
with open(LOG_FILE_PATH, 'a') as log_file: | |
log_file.write(json.dumps(data) + '\n') | |
while True: | |
# Get access token | |
access_token = get_access_token() | |
# Get start/end times for 2 minute intervals | |
end_time = datetime.utcnow().replace(microsecond=0).isoformat() + 'Z' | |
start_time = (datetime.utcnow() - timedelta(minutes=2)).replace(microsecond=0).isoformat() + 'Z' | |
# Get detections and detection details for the past 2 minutes every 2 minutes and write to log file | |
try: | |
detections = get_detections(access_token, start_time, end_time) | |
for detection in detections: | |
detection_details = get_detection(access_token, detection["Id"]) | |
write_to_log_file(detection_details) | |
except Exception as e: | |
with open(LOG_FILE_PATH, 'a') as log_file: | |
log_file.write(f'Error: {str(e)}\n') | |
time.sleep(120) # Wait for 2 minutes before fetching data again |
